Resource Books for Teachers Beginners
Category: UMK Resource Books for Teachers author (author): Series Editor: Alan Maley publisher: Oxford University Press year: 2000-2010 language: British English format: PDF,
Oxford Resource Books for Teachers is a series of tutorials on teaching English for elementary and high school. These manuals are distinguished by non-standard methodological approaches in the field of teaching children with the use of unusual resources as teaching tools.

Focus On PET: Preliminary English Test: SB (1996)
This coursebook is designed to prepare students for the Cambridge Preliminary English Test. Each unit is linked to the topic areas on the exam syllabus so key vocabulary areas are covered thoroughly, and each contains balanced skills work which prepares students gradually.
